Offered for sale is this darling, all original Ideal Baby Beautiful. According to my research, this doll was made from 1945-1947 by the Ideal Toy Company.

This little cutie is so crisp and original, it's hard to believe that she is actually this old! Her composition is very clean and shows no signs of crazing. She has a composition head, lower arms and lower legs. Her cloth body is very clean and there is a bit of an opening on her cloth body on the side of her head where her flange neck is attached with wire. She has a crier inside that no longer functions. She measures approximately 16 inches in length. She has molded brown painted hair, with the typical molded squiggley curls on her forehead. There is one tiny pop to the composition on the top of her head (See photos). She has single stroke painted eyebrows over her well functioning blue sleep eyes. The irises are very bright and clear. She is missing almost all of her eyelashes on her right eye, while the ones on her left eye seem to be present (with a couple of little shorter areas). These are the only flaws that I can find with this baby. She has lots of lower painted eyelashes, sweet little upturned nose, red painted lips around her tiny open mouth showing 2 little teeth (it looks like these are backed with a red felt "tongue"), and lots of sweet blushing on her cheeks, ear lobes, backs of her hands and knees.

Her clothing consists of the following:

• Original organza gown that is embellished with topstitching. This topstitching actually makes it look like embroidery. There is a very small tag stitched into the center back seam but there doesn't seem to be any printing on it. The sleeve openings have elastic (it still has a bit of stretch to it) in them and just the tiniest hint of pink stitched edging. There is a pink ribbon bow at the center of the front. The back closes with two pearl looking buttons with corresponding button holes.

• Original matching organza bonnet. This has pink ribbon ties that match the bow on the front of the gown. The bonnet has a nice ruffled trim that also has the subtle pink colored stitched edging.

• Sleeveless muslin slip. This is very simply made, with a machine serging on the neckline and sleeve openings. The hem has a lace edging. The back opening is finished and fastens with a small brass safety pin.

• Muslin underpants. These have elastic in the leg openings that is still fairly stretchy. There is a waistband, and they close with a simple brass safety pin.

• Pink and white knit booties that fasten on her feet with pink ribbon that matches the ribbon on the rest of her wardrobe. These appear to have never been removed from her feet, and I did not attempt to take them off, for fear of damage to the booties. Her feet feel fine under these booties.

The original Ideal Doll tag is still with her. It is a gold color, measures approximately 1 3/8 inches in diameter, has a scalloped edge to it and attaches to the doll with a heavy black string. The printing (in black and red) is identical on both sides of the tag and indicates that it is "An Ultrafine Product/ An Ideal Doll/ Made in. U.S.A. By/ Ideal Novelty & Toy Co./ Long Island City New York."

Neither the doll nor its clothing have any odors.
